Okay! I want to know more about your four main protagonists from True North! Questions for all: 1. Name and Age 2. How is their relationship with sleep? 3. What type of colors are they drawn to and why? 4. What feels like home to them? 5. What can they not live without? 6. Do you have any faceclaims for them?
Thank you! This will also help me flesh them out so much so…!!
1) Names and Age
 Faolan Cahl is about 26 years old.
Captain Cayden is around 23.
Aella Lyall is also 23. 
Lexi Lyall is 24.
2) Relationship with Sleep
Faolan is a war chief by origin, but given his Reaver aspect, he sleeps pretty well. He has zero issue and is more like a giant lazy dog when not fighting. He doesn’t sleep in long bursts though, his body is used to taking little naps and operating itself in shifts. He can sleep just about anywhere, on anything, and when he tries to sleep it’s an INSTANT sleep. Fear him.
Cayden sleeps best on boats and ships, the swaying and creaking and sound of the waves are home to him, he’s a whole new man on ships - good rests, nice dreams, he sleeps like a baby. But on land everything is solid and still, and won’t give him that comfort, so he’ll toss and turn all night and take like… An hour to actually shut his eyes and rest. To help him sleep he’ll drink some whiskey before bed ordinarily.
Aella is the lightest fucking sleeper omg. She’s the first Lady Knight and has to always be alert and ready for both shifts in patrols, early training sessions in the courtyard or attacks and sudden missions. Her body is too stressed to stay asleep long. She always ends up going to sleep drunk, usually after a brawl in the tavern. Without alcohol in her system she’ll wake at Lexi turning a page in a book. So, she also gets sleeping drafts for when she doesn’t have her own cure.
Lexi is a dreamer by nature so her relationship to sleep is welcome, she’s only recently started getting nightmares but ordinarily, her feelings on sleep are great! She can sleep after coming up with stories in her head, and then she’s such a fucking deep sleeper it’s unreal. A battle could be going on right beside her between 20 men and this bitch is still snoozing soundly, curled up in blankets.
3) Colours and Why.
Faolan likes blacks and reds. Blacks kinda blend anywhere and red is - you guessed it! - blood. Reavers, man. Reavers. He isn’t really sure why beyond the fact it’s blood and coals.
Cayden likes rich, bright colours. Like reds and golds and deep blues. Purples. Silvers. He’s very picky about mixing them and has a good eye for what goes with what. He’s a pirate, so anything that looks flashy. His favourite changes like the sea though so idefk with this man. 
Aella prefers purples and spiceberry. She just finds them inviting and warm colours. She’s pretty practical so she doesn’t know why, she just knows she has this scarf that she attaches to her shoulder pauldron that’s kinda like this mini shoulder cape that’s purple and spiceberry. It was given to her by her aunt. (it was her mothers scarf)
Lexi likes greens and blues, and yellow. She likes the colours of nature basically, because she’s an apothecarian, she works with a lot of colourful flowers and appreciates the beauty of it all. Normally she likes more.. Pastels. Like pastel blue. It’s like the sky. But deeper greens like the forest.
4) What Feels Like Home?
For Faolan, he was brought up in woods and learned to fight by mountains. Any place wild and unruly, and untrailed, is where he thrives and feels more comfortable. Thick forests, perilous mountain passes, long grass and jagged cliff ledges and caves. He finds home there.
Cayden’s home is the sea. He’s Stormborn, so hearing the rumble of thunder in the distance is less of an omen for him and also more a comfort, but definitely the sea. If he can’t be ON the sea, he needs to be NEXT to the sea. If not that then he’ll need to go to a tavern to hear loud, rowdy men and women and he’ll surround himself in the drunken joy because it reminds him of his crew.
Aella feels home with Lexi. Her cousin and her have been alone for so long, and it’s been such a struggle to keep afloat, but everything she’s done and does, is to keep them safe. As long as Lexi is beside her and smiling and laughing, Aella is at ease. Her second home is a tavern though, but she won’t go as far to say all taverns. Unlike Cayden. She needs to be familiar with the place first.
Like Aella, Lexi finds her home with Aella. The girls do everything for each other, they are best friends and family, and Lexi doesn’t mind where she ends up so long as Aella’s still there. On the side, for an actual place, the woods is where she finds her comforts. With the tree’s and the flowers. She knows secret routes and hidden parts of the forest. It’s a solace when she’s surrounded by nature and good energy like that.
5) What Can They Not Live Without?
Despite each other?
Faolan needs his sword. He gets twitchy if he doesn’t have it near or on his person. Warriors of Clan Cahl name their chosen weapons - they are super sacred to his people. To lose your sword isn’t an insult or anything like that, but it’s known to send some warriors into a panic, like they’ve just lost their child or friend. Since they’re buried with their weapons, it’s a huge deal for them that not a lot outside The Dhalmarri people would understand. He needs his sword, which counts, yet as a whole, what he can’t live without is his people. Everything he is and have done is for his people. Everything he achieved and fought for. The Dhalmarri is his everything, and why he became King was only for the good of them.
Cayden is a pretty simple man despite all his spark, what he truly can’t live without is music. You thought I’d say his ship or the sea, or his hat? He loves his captains hat but for sanity, he can’t live without music. Be it through shanties, mere humming, or a melodic strum of guitar from bards. He can play instruments and sing himself so if he can’t hear anything near by, he’ll make his own. Music to him is like listening to a soul. Music unifys and has a power stronger, and older, than even the most wisest sorcerer can explain. If asked outright however? He’ll say booze or coin. He’ll joke and brush it all off.
Aella can’t live without combat. Bluntly put, she needs the fight. There’s no deep, underlining meaning behind it, she’s a simple fighter who craves the heat of battle. She protects, attacks and conquers. She’s the most alive when fighting, be it through pointless bar brawls or for something/someone. Lexi’s joked that she should just become a mercenary on many occasions, and had it not been for the death risk - she would have taken it seriously.
Lexi can’t live without adventure. Adventure and her books. Lexi is driven to explore and find things - be it something as simple as a new route to gather herbs, or an adventure in they city. She truly shines in new places, and finding new things, secrets. Lexi is also an avid reader, which ties into her craving for adventure, pages can carry you to new worlds and take you on grand ventures into uncharted paths. She dreams both big and small. 
6) Faceclaims For Them?
This is the most difficult question because they aren’t just average looking people and to fc them severely limits what I have in my head since, y’know, fantasy characters. BUT IT WON’T STOP ME TRYING! 
Faolan I’ve yet to find one for. He’s difficult af ok, I still cry at night. NO ONE WORKS. He’s more or less POC, but bc it’s a fantasy world, and not fully cementing with certain races being from THIS place or THAT, it’s difficult to find a face for him.
Cayden would essentially be Andy Biersak with heterochromia, ngl. Dem cheekbones. I used him as Yosh for my DA stuff but was way off on that bc Yosh is POC it was just the closest facual structure wise I could get. Cayden isn’t a POC and Andy is actually startlingly close to what I’m picturing. (though i am still on the lookout) 
The girls are so much easier ok, bless you girls.
Aella closely resembles Segovia Amil. Slayin’ with the eyebrows and the fierce look of ominous. Threateningly beautiful.
Lexi’s closest is Astrid Berges Frisbey. Protect her. Look at that face. So innocent. (she’ll kick ur butt and outsmart you thrice over tho)

op what are your character's in the aella story's superpowers??
Cerys has black fire, her fire turns whatever it touches into ash. Euna has invisibility, though she can turn it on and off. Orion has super speed, doesn't help that he's clumsy. Airi has size manipulation, she can change how big or small she is. Cedrick has flower emission, he can emit a flowery scent based on his emotions.
Idalia has teleportation, though she can only go to places she knows. Lyra has angel wings. Aleric has fire body, he can turn himself into fire and can even hide himself inside fires. Elliot has portal generation, though the portals can only be made to places he knows. Jay has hard light constructs, he can make anything he can think of out of light but his favorite is a bow and arrow.
Aderyn has telekinesis, she can control things with her mind. Caius has shapeshifting, he can turn into people he's seen before. Aella has firebreathing, though it does burn her mouth and throat sometimes. Ezra has intangibility, he can phase through things and be generally untouchable at will. Aleron has ice body, he can turn himself into ice and can hide himself in water and icy terrains.
Wren has electric aura, he can create a sort of second skin made of electricity. Adie has water control. Dakota has darkness manipulation. Dolly has force fields, though it takes a minute to make them so far. Sage has light manipulation. Emrys has rainbow fire, she can make different colored fires that do different things. Seline has diamond skin.
Jamie has sunsplit, where they can turn into glass-like material, making them a working prism that they can bend light though, creating beams of rainbow light they can use to cut as well as can make themself into a blinding light display. Adalynn has weapon generation, she can summon any weapon she's seen. Macie has zodiac empowerment, she has different powers based on which she activates.
Ailey has energy body, she can turn into pure energy. Mera has fog generation, she can make fog however dense or thin she wants. Malachi has elasticity, he can stretch himself and contort himself however he wants. Cecil has illumination, he can basically turn into a walking talking glow stick, he can blind people if he makes himself too bright. Jasper has bioluminescence, he can make small bubbles of light, able to bake things he touches glow for a short while, and able to make himself glow.
